Introduction
Kylie Jenner has become a cultural icon and a prominent figure in the business world. Her entrepreneurial journey, which began with the launch of Kylie Cosmetics in 2015, has transformed her into a self-made billionaire. Her savvy use of social media, understanding of market trends, and ability to build a strong personal brand have been instrumental in her success. This article provides an in-depth look at Kylie Jenner's business ventures, examining her strategies, successes, and the challenges she faces.
What & Why

- Direct-to-Consumer (DTC) Model: Jenner has largely bypassed traditional retail channels, focusing on selling directly to consumers through e-commerce. This allows for greater control over branding, pricing, and customer data.
- Social Media Marketing: Jenner's massive social media following (particularly on Instagram and TikTok) has been a powerful marketing tool. She directly promotes her products, creates engaging content, and interacts with her audience, fostering a strong connection.
- Trend-Driven Products: Jenner is adept at identifying and capitalizing on beauty trends, launching products that resonate with her target demographic, primarily young women.
- Influencer Marketing: Collaborations with other influencers, celebrities, and beauty gurus have expanded her reach and credibility.
- Strategic Partnerships: Partnerships with established brands, manufacturers, and retailers have helped in production, distribution, and wider market penetration.

How-To / Steps / Framework Application
Understanding how Kylie Jenner has built her empire can be broken down into a few key steps:
- Product Development and Launch: Jenner identifies trends and gaps in the market, particularly in the beauty sector. This includes developing products (lip kits, eyeshadow palettes, etc.) and creating compelling packaging and branding. Product launches are often timed with social media campaigns to maximize impact.
- Marketing and Promotion: Jenner utilizes her massive social media following to market her products. Content includes product demonstrations, behind-the-scenes looks, and collaborations. This strategy fosters engagement and drives sales. Influencer marketing is another key component.
- Direct-to-Consumer Sales: Jenner's websites (or those of partnerships) serve as the primary sales channel. This allows her to directly control the customer experience, collect data, and maintain higher profit margins. It also allows her to adapt to consumer feedback and market changes rapidly.
- Brand Expansion: Beyond Kylie Cosmetics, Jenner expanded her brand to include Kylie Skin (skincare) and Kylie Baby (baby products). These are examples of leveraging her brand to target different market segments.
- Strategic Partnerships and Licensing: Jenner has partnered with major retailers (e.g., Ulta) and manufacturers (e.g., Coty) to scale production, distribution, and market penetration. These partnerships help streamline operations and reduce operational costs.

Examples & Use Cases
Kylie Jenner's business strategy is evident in numerous examples:
- Kylie Cosmetics Lip Kits: The initial lip kits were a major success, capitalizing on the trend of fuller lips. The kits were marketed through Jenner's social media channels, driving massive demand and often selling out quickly.
- Kylie Skin Launch: The launch of Kylie Skin utilized a social media campaign showcasing Jenner's skincare routine and promoting the products' benefits. The campaign targeted younger audiences and promoted the ease and simplicity of her product line.
- Kylie Baby: Jenner's launch of Kylie Baby targeted the lucrative baby market, building on her personal brand and focusing on gentle, safe products for babies. The branding and packaging utilized a soft, natural aesthetic.
- Partnership with Coty: The partnership with Coty allowed Kylie Cosmetics to scale production, distribution, and global reach. This has expanded the availability of her products and facilitated expansion into new markets.
- Retail Partnerships: Placing Kylie Cosmetics in Ulta stores provides wider accessibility and visibility. Retail presence increases brand credibility and drives sales, offering consumers a more traditional shopping experience.
These examples highlight how Jenner has effectively utilized her brand, social media, and strategic partnerships to build a successful and multifaceted business empire.
